Is ascariasis a waterborne disease?

Ascaris is due to fecal-oral contact. So it is either food or water that have been contaminated by fecal material.

What is the environment of quartzite?

Quartzite is a Metamorphic Rock that undergos extreme heat and pressure forcing pre-existing rocks to recrystalize. It forms through contact metamorphism. It's formed at an igneous intrusion cutting through existing rock in a small area; usually along cooled igneus intrusions.

Who does plastic pollution affect and how?

Plastics are organic polymers with extremely low reactivity towards the environmental factrs, thus have the ability to remain intact for around 25,000-50,000 years on the earth, without decomposing. Now the question is; if we kept on manufacturing more and more plastic on a daily basis, without doing something about decomposing it, what will we do with a world full of plastic scrap in 20-25 years. That why scientists are urging people to use decomposable plastics and recycle the one already made. Also, some plastics are toxic to wildlife and marine life.

What kind of health problems does air and water pollution cause?

Air pollution can cause health problems that include:

  • breathing problems
  • asthma
  • lung damage
  • irritated eyes
  • stuffy nose
  • reduced resistance to colds and infections
  • premature aging of lung tissue

Water pollution can cause:

  • illness from bacteria and other pathogens
  • illness and genetic problems from heavy metals
  • digestive system difficulties
  • dehydration due to excess salts or phosphates

What are the causes and effects of air pollution?

The primary air pollutants found in most urban areas are carbon monoxide, nitrogen oxides, sulfur oxides, hydrocarbons, and particulate matter (both solid and liquid). These pollutants are dispersed throughout the world's atmosphere in concentrations high enough to gradually cause serious health problems. Serious health problems can occur quickly when air pollutants are concentrated, such as when massive injections of sulfur dioxide and suspended particulate matter are emitted by a large volcanic eruption. Causes of Air Pollution:

  • noxious gasses into atmosphere
  • most large industries
  • motor vehicles (automobiles, airplanes, jets, rockets, etc.)
  • Automobile is the leading contributor pollution in cities
  • coal burning power plants
  • fuel combustion
  • natural fires

Effects of Air Pollution:

  • large cities have smog in the air
  • heath concerns (young and elderly are the easiest targets) include: Asthma, Heart disease, lung disease, itchy eyes, sinuses, scratchy throats
  • atmosphere layers will be damaged and clogged by pollutants
  • acid rain- pollution is combined with the air's moisture and result is acidic rain
  • global warming- pollutants around atmosphere traps heat and increases the temperature

Why does the water around the hydrosphere become polluted during a tsunami?

Freshwater sources in areas flooded by a tsunami can become contaminated by salty seawater. Various substances and debris that a tsunami picks up can also end up in the water as pollutants.

How does agriculture contribute to ground water pollution?

Fertilizers used in agricultural areas tend to get washed away by rainfall and can end up in local water sources. These chemicals can cause fish to die near-instantly because of the nitrogen poisoning in the water and aggressive aquatic plants like algae can grow rampant.
